Maintaining a HEPA air filter in your air purifier is crucial to ensuring a healthier and more comfortable indoor environment. HEPA Air Filters are highly efficient, capturing up to 99.97% of airborne particles as small as 0.3 microns, such as dust, pollen, pet dander, bacteria, and even some viruses. Regular cleaning and maintenance protect this efficiency, extend filter life, and uphold air quality throughout your space.[11]

HEPA stands for High-Efficiency Particulate Air. This filter type consists of a dense mesh of fibers, typically fiberglass, arranged to trap microscopic particles by interception, impaction, and diffusion. HEPA Air Filters are common in air purifiers, HVAC systems, and cleanroom equipment because of their rigorous standards for particle removal.[11]

A clean HEPA Air Filter ensures maximum airflow and particle capture. Over weeks and months, airborne pollutants accumulate in the filter's fibers, diminishing airflow and purifying capacity. A clogged filter can cause your air purifier to work harder, consume more energy, and operate less effectively, potentially releasing some trapped particles back into your room.[6]

- Check if your air purifier model uses a washable HEPA Air Filter. Read the manual for specific care instructions, as not all HEPA Air Filters are designed to be cleaned—some require replacement.[1][6]
- Gather supplies: vacuum cleaner with brush attachment, soft brush (if needed), mild detergent (for washable filters), and a clean towel.
Always turn off and unplug your air purifier before opening the filter compartment to avoid electrical hazards and accidental damage.[1][6]
Follow the manufacturer's instructions to carefully remove the HEPA Air Filter. Most filter compartments are located at the back or bottom of the device and may have tabs or handles for easy extraction.[6][1]
Examine the HEPA Air Filter for visible damage such as tears or discoloration. If the filter appears compromised or excessively clogged, it's safer to replace it rather than attempt cleaning.[6]
If your filter is not washable, use these methods:
- Vacuuming: Gently run the vacuum's brush attachment over the filter surface to remove loose dirt and dust, taking extra care around the folds.[1][6]
- Light Tapping: If allowed (check your user manual), gently tap the filter to dislodge embedded particles.[6]
- Avoid Liquids: Never use water or detergent on a non-washable filter, as moisture will damage the delicate fiber mesh and reduce effectiveness.[6]
For washable models:
- Vacuum First: Remove surface debris before rinsing.
- Rinse Under Water: Hold the HEPA Air Filter under a moderate stream of cold or lukewarm water. Rotate and rinse both sides thoroughly, allowing water to flush out trapped particles.[6]
- Use Mild Detergent: If needed, prepare a dilute solution of mild, non-abrasive detergent. Submerge and gently agitate the filter without scrubbing. Rinse completely to ensure no soap remains.[1][6]
- Air Dry: Lay the HEPA Air Filter flat on a towel or drying rack in a well-ventilated spot. Allow it to dry naturally—never use hair dryers, heaters, or direct sunlight, which may warp or damage the fibers.[6]
- Only Reinstall When Bone-Dry: Installing a damp HEPA Air Filter can foster mold and impact air quality.[6]

- Inspect Monthly: Check the HEPA Air Filter every month for dust buildup or discoloration, especially in dusty or high-traffic environments.[11]
- Routine Cleaning: Homes with pets, smokers, or high pollen counts may need more frequent cleaning.
- Replace Pre-Filters: Many purifiers use pre-filters to catch larger particles, reducing the load on your HEPA Air Filter. Replace these every 3–6 months.[7]
- Regular Unit Cleaning: Clean the inside and exterior of your air purifier, focusing on areas near the filter—accumulated dust and particles can hinder unit efficiency.[7]
- Cleaning Non-Washable Filters: Some HEPA Air Filters are made strictly for replacement. Washing or wetting these filters can permanently damage them, making your air purifier less effective or even unsafe.[6]
- Using Harsh Chemicals: Only use manufacturer-approved mild detergents. Strong chemicals can degrade filter fibers.
- Impatient Drying: Never reinstall a filter before it is fully dry—moisture in HEPA filters encourages mold growth and reduces air quality.
- Neglecting Manufacturer Instructions: Each air purifier brand has distinct recommendations for cleaning and replacement. Always follow official guidelines.
Most manufacturers suggest inspecting HEPA Air Filters monthly and cleaning (if possible) every 1–3 months. If your purifier runs continuously or your environment is dusty, more frequent attention may be needed. Even thorough cleaning cannot restore a filter indefinitely—replace your HEPA Air Filter every 6–12 months per your manufacturer's recommendation, or when you notice:[1][6]
- Reduced airflow or purifier efficiency.
- Persistent odors not eliminated by cleaning.
- Visible damage (tears, deformation, or mold).

Most users should inspect their HEPA Air Filter monthly and clean it every 1–3 months, depending on use and air quality. If you live in a dusty area or have pets, consider more frequent cleaning.[1][6]
No, not every HEPA Air Filter is washable. Many are designed for dry cleaning only or direct replacement. Always consult your air purifier's manual before cleaning to avoid damaging your filter.[6]
Key indicators include reduced airflow, odd smells, visible dirt that doesn't go away with cleaning, physical damage, or mold on the filter surface.[6]
Air dry your HEPA Air Filter completely on a towel or rack in a ventilated area. Avoid artificial heat sources and direct sunlight. It may take several hours or up to a full day depending on humidity.[6]
Cleaning a HEPA Air Filter can remove some trapped particles and improve efficiency, but not indefinitely. Over time, filter fibers fill up and lose effectiveness. Regular replacement is essential for optimal air purification.[6]
